At a meeting with the government leadership on May 5, Alexander Lukashenka shared an idea of how to use reclaimed plots near Minsk, which currently belong to the Dzyarzhynski agro-combine.

According to Lukashenka, he liked this area, and therefore a large apple orchard should be planted there.
He also sees who can be entrusted with this project — the head of the "Spartan-agro" farm from near Maladzyechna, Ihar Abramchyk.
Lukashenka believes that the creation of a large orchard near the capital could fully supply Minsk with apples and reduce dependence on supplies from other regions and countries.
